THE OSCARS HAD A GOOD NIGHT _ The Oscars telecast was seen by 40.3 million people, a slight increase over last year's show. The Nielsen Company said Monday it was the most-watched Oscars telecast in three years. Last year's show, when "The Artist" won best picture, had an audience of 39.3 million people. After bringing in "Family Guy" creator Seth MacFarlane as host this year, ABC saw an 11 percent ratings boost over 2012 (among viewers ages 18 to 49 years old).

... The Academy Awards exceeded 40 million viewers four times in the previous 10 years.

SENATE PANEL DROPS PROBE OF BIN LADEN RAID FILM _ One day after Zero Dark Thirty failed to win major awards at the Oscars, the Senate Intelligence Committee has closed its inquiry into the filmmakers' contacts with the Central Intelligence Agency. A source says the intelligence committee gathered more information from the CIA, film director Kathryn Bigelow, and screenwriter Mark Boal and will not take further action. Zero Dark Thirty was nominated for a best picture award.

NETFLIX ONLY DOING ONE SEASON OF ARRESTED DEVELOPMENT _ For fans of the short-lived but much-adored former Fox sitcom Arrested Development, the show’s impending return on Netflix has been reason to stay with the video-streaming service. But Monday the company announced it will only be doing a single season of the show. The new episodes, scheduled to debut in May, will follow the pattern set by recently debuted Netflix original House of Cards: all of the episodes will be released at once.

... But any dreams of this becoming a recurring event were dashed Monday when Netflix CEO Reed Hasting said that a second season of Arrested Development was “non-repeatable.” A Netflix rep said that it is “extremely difficult to get the cast together.”

... Netflix has said that House of Cards has done remarkably well for the company, and it’s believed that the Kevin Spacey series will return for at least one more season.
